Sudan War: How Abu Lulu Became 'The Butcher Of Al Fasher'

As more details of the atrocities of Sudan's paramilitary Rapid Support Forces against civilians emerge, one name notoriously stands out - Abu Lulu.

He is nicknamed “The Butcher of Al-Fasher” for his brutal role in the executions of civilians, boasting that he personally killed more than 2,000 people and filmed atrocities he committed.

So, who is Abu Lulu and how did he become brutally powerful?
